4/17/10 - Big Effort From Laureano All For Not
By Stephanie Coats
Photo by Kelly Kappen
Fullerton, CA- In their second to last home match of the season, the Royals played their usual strong, consistent tennis versus Azusa Pacific. The Cougars showed why they are ranked No. 5 in the NAIA as they refused to yield to the Royals and eventually won 9-0.
Freshman Jerry Laureano , pictured, started out a bit slow against Danny Colten but picked up his game in the first set to come away with a game win. While Laureano would be unable to add any other wins to his record for the first set, he rallied in the second set to win four more games. Pushing hard to make the most of those wins, Laureano sough to force the match to a decisive third set. Colten was able to hold Laureano off just enough to take the set and match win 2-0 (6-1, 6-4).
Also on the singles court, Freshman Justin Sutherlin nabbed a game win of his own off Whitman Hough in the second set. Despite a valiant effort, Sutherlin would not be able to take down Hough. He would lose 2-0 (6-0, 6-1).
Earlier in the day, Hough and partner Ilja Ikonnikov faced off against Laureano and Freshman Greg Cobian. The pair of Royals earned one game win yet could not rack up any others. Laureano and Cobian were defeated 8-1.

With the loss today, the Royals display a record of 1-17, 0-12 GSAC and Azusa Pacific holds a 15-4, 9-3 GSAC record of their own. On Tuesday, the Royals’ final away match of the season will be versus Fresno Pacific staring at 2:00 pm.
